SAMC is one of only two sites in Alabama that can reattach hands and fingers that have been completely cut off, a procedure known to surgeons as “replants.” A two-finger replant was recently performed at SAMC by orthopedic surgeon and hand specialist Dr. Skip Chitwood. Dr. Chitwood says that the specialty of hand surgery was started during World War II due to traumatic injuries to soldiers. If a soldier’s upper extremities were injured it would require the work of many type of surgeons to take care of the injury…orthopedics for the bones, vascular surgeons for the veins, microsurgeons for the nerve repairs and then plastic surgeons for the outer hand.
